Preview

Colombia National Football Team square off with Peru National Football Team in the Qualifying of the World Cup action on June 3. The match is set to start at 22:00 UTC.

Tensions run high as the upcoming match sees Colombia and Peru are set to clash again, 9 months after the previous World Cup Qualifying encounter which ended in a draw 1-1. Colombia come into the match following a draw against Paraguay on March 26 in the World Cup Qualifying. If they hope to shift momentum in their favor, addressing defensive lapses will be essential, given that they have struggled to keep opponents from scoring, conceding in their last four matches.

Peru are heading into this match following a defeat to Venezuela in the World Cup Qualifying on March 26. They have struggled to make an impact, having gone five away matches without finding the net, putting pressure on their attack to deliver.

This World Cup Qualifying clash shines a light on the players who have played crucial roles in creating and converting chances for Colombia National Football Team and Peru National Football Team in this campaign. Colombia’s attacking options have been bolstered by Luis Diaz, the team’s top scorer, and James Rodriguez, both of whom have contributed crucial goals and assists. Diaz has already scored six goals in World Cup Qualifying this season, while Rodriguez remains their top assist provider in the competition with four. Jhon Arias, Luis Sinisterra and Rafael Borre have also played key roles, contributing with goals and assists to fuel Colombia’s attack.

Meanwhile, Peru’s offensive unit has leaned on Andy Polo and Paolo Guerrero, their main scorer, as they continue to drive the team’s attacking efforts forward. Polo has emerged as Peru’s leading scorer in World Cup Qualifying this season, netting one goal, while also leading the team in assists, having set up one goal this campaign. Gianluca Lapadula, Edison Flores and Andy Polo have made their presence felt as well, chipping in with decisive contributions in attack.

Head-to-head

Since November 2019, the teams have clashed six times. Colombia have won three times, Peru twice, with the remaining one ending as draw. The last time these teams met was on September 7, 2024, in the Qualifying of the World Cup, concluding in a 1-1 draw. In total, Colombia have managed nine goals in these six meetings, compared to Peru's six. So far, Colombia have proven stronger in their recent head-to-head record against Peru.

Colombia have won five of their thirteen matches in World Cup Qualifying this season, with four draws and four defeats, netting sixteen goals (1.23 per match) and conceding twelve (0.92 per match). In World Cup Qualifying, Peru have played thirteen matches, winning two, drawing four and losing seven, scoring six goals at an average of 0.46 per match and conceding sixteen at a rate of 1.23 per match.

Recent Form

Colombia are coming off a draw in their last match against Paraguay, while Peru's most recent outing ended in a loss against Venezuela. Overall, Colombia have won twelve of their last twenty matches, losing five and drawing three, while over their most recent twenty games, Peru have claimed five victories, suffered nine defeats, and drawn six times.

  • Peru haven't played a draw in their previous 8 away matches.
  • Colombia have gone 4 consecutive matches without a clean sheet.
  • Peru have gone 3 consecutive matches without a clean sheet.
